PHP Development: Delivering Robust, Secure, and Custom Website Design
PHP is a widely used general-purpose programming language that has become a cornerstone of custom website design. Its versatility, efficiency, and a vast community of developers make it a popular choice for building dynamic and interactive websites.
One of the key advantages of PHP is its ability to create custom website design tailored to specific business needs. Unlike content management systems (CMS) that offer limited customization options, PHP allows for complete control over the website’s structure, functionality, and appearance. This flexibility enables businesses to create unique and engaging online experiences that differentiate themselves from competitors.
PHP’s open-source nature and large community contribute to its ongoing development and support. This means that developers have access to a wealth of resources, including frameworks, libraries, and tutorials, which can accelerate custom website design projects. Additionally, the active community ensures that PHP remains up to date with the latest web development trends and technologies.
Another significant benefit of PHP is its performance. PHP is known for its speed and efficiency, allowing websites to load quickly and provide a seamless user experience. This is especially important in today’s fast-paced digital world, where users expect websites to be responsive and load instantly.
Furthermore, PHP is highly versatile and can be used to develop a wide range of custom website design projects, from simple landing pages to complex e-commerce platforms. Its integration with popular databases like MySQL and PostgreSQL makes it ideal for handling data-driven applications.
In conclusion, PHP is a powerful and versatile language that is well-suited for custom website design. Its flexibility, efficiency, and strong community support make it a popular choice among developers. By leveraging PHP, businesses can create dynamic, interactive, and high-performing websites that meet their unique needs and drive success.
Here are some of the key benefits of using PHP for web development:
Scalability: PHP is highly scalable, making it suitable for both small and large-scale web applications. It can handle increasing traffic and data loads without compromising performance.
Flexibility: PHP offers a high degree of flexibility, allowing developers to create a wide range of web applications, from simple static websites to complex e-commerce platforms.
Cost-effectiveness: PHP is an open-source language, which means it is free to use. This can significantly reduce development costs compared to proprietary languages.
Large community and ecosystem: PHP has a vast community of developers, which means there are plenty of resources, frameworks, and libraries available to support development efforts.
Overview of the Guide
This guide will provide you with a comprehensive overview of custom website design using PHP. We will cover the following topics:
The basics of PHP: Understanding the syntax, variables, and data types.
Common PHP functions and libraries: Learning about popular PHP functions and libraries that can be used to build dynamic websites.
Creating a PHP website: Step-by-step instructions on how to create a basic PHP website.
Best practices for PHP development: Tips for writing clean, efficient, and maintainable PHP code.
Integrating PHP with other technologies: How to integrate PHP with databases, frameworks, and other technologies.
By the end of this guide, you will have a solid understanding of custom website design using PHP and be well-equipped to create your own dynamic and interactive websites.
Understanding PHP Development: A Comprehensive Guide
When it comes to creating a custom website design that truly stands out, PHP is a highly versatile and effective programming language. Its simplicity, flexibility, and extensive community support make it an ideal choice for developers seeking to build dynamic and interactive web applications.
One of the key advantages of PHP for custom website design is its ease of use. With a relatively straightforward syntax and many available resources, PHP is accessible to developers of all skill levels. This makes it easier to learn and implement, allowing for faster development cycles and reduced costs.
Another strength of PHP is its flexibility. It can be used to create a wide range of custom website designs, from simple static pages to complex e-commerce platforms. Whether you need a website with dynamic content, interactive features, or database integration, PHP has the capabilities to deliver.
Furthermore, PHP benefits from a thriving community of developers who contribute to its ongoing development and provide valuable support. This active community ensures that PHP remains up to date with the latest web technologies and offers a wealth of resources, libraries, and frameworks to streamline custom website design projects.
Understanding PHP Development
What is PHP? PHP is a server-side scripting language used to create dynamic web pages. It is embedded within HTML code and executed on the server, generating the HTML that is sent to the user’s browser.
Key Features of PHP: PHP offers numerous features that make it a versatile language for web development, including:
Cross-platform compatibility: PHP runs on various operating systems and web servers.
Large community support: A vast community of developers contributes to PHP’s growth and development.
Object-oriented programming: PHP supports object-oriented programming principles for better code organization and reusability.
Database integration: PHP seamlessly integrates with popular databases like MySQL, PostgreSQL, and Oracle.
Rich ecosystem: A wide range of frameworks, libraries, and tools are available for PHP development.
PHP Frameworks: Simplifying Development
PHP frameworks provide a structured approach to web development, offering pre-built components and best practices. Using a framework can significantly speed up development time and improve code quality. Some popular PHP frameworks include:
Laravel: A full-stack PHP framework is known for its elegant syntax, powerful features, and extensive community support.
Symfony: A component-based framework that offers flexibility and scalability.
CodeIgniter: A lightweight and easy-to-learn framework suitable for smaller projects.
Choosing the Right PHP Framework
The best PHP framework for your project depends on various factors, including:
Project complexity: For complex projects, frameworks like Laravel or Symfony may be more suitable.
Development team expertise: Consider the skills and experience of your development team when choosing a framework.
Project timeline: Some frameworks offer faster development times than others.
Specific requirements: Evaluate your project’s specific requirements to determine which framework best aligns with your needs.
Benefits of PHP Development for Custom Website Design
Flexibility: PHP allows for highly customizable and dynamic websites.
Scalability: PHP can manage high traffic loads and scale to accommodate growing businesses.
Cost-effectiveness: PHP is an open-source language, making it a cost-effective option for custom website design.
Large community support: A vast community of PHP developers provides extensive resources, documentation, and support.
Integration with other technologies: PHP can be easily integrated with other technologies, such as JavaScript and databases.
By leveraging the power of PHP, you can create custom website design solutions that meet your specific business needs and deliver exceptional user experiences. Whether you are building a simple website or a complex web application, PHP offers a robust and versatile platform for development.
Best Practices for PHP Development
PHP is a widely used programming language for web development. Adhering to best practices can significantly enhance the quality, efficiency, and maintainability of your PHP projects.
Code Readability and Maintainability
Consistent coding style: Use a consistent coding style throughout your project to improve readability and maintainability.
Meaningful variable and function names: Choose descriptive names that accurately reflect the purpose of variables and functions.
Comments: Add comments to explain complex logic or non-obvious code sections.
Modularization: Break down your code into smaller, reusable modules to improve organization and maintainability.
Security Best Practices
Input validation: Sanitize user input to prevent security vulnerabilities like SQL injection and cross-site scripting (XSS).
Regular updates: Keep your PHP installation and dependencies up to date to address security vulnerabilities.
Secure coding practices: Follow secure coding guidelines to avoid common security pitfalls.
Data encryption: Encrypt sensitive data to protect it from unauthorized access.
Performance Optimization
Caching: Implement caching mechanisms to reduce database queries and improve page load times.
Database optimization: Optimize your database queries and indexes for efficient performance.
Minimize HTTP requests: Reduce the number of HTTP requests to improve page load speed.
Compress assets: Compress CSS, JavaScript, and images to reduce file size and improve performance.
Testing and Quality Assurance
Unit testing: Write unit tests to verify the correctness of individual code components.
Integration testing: Test how different components of your application interact with each other.
User acceptance testing (UAT): Ensure that your application meets the requirements of your users.
Continuous integration and continuous delivery (CI/CD): Automate the build, test, and deployment process to improve efficiency and quality.
PHP Development Services
Concept Infoway is a leading custom website design company that offers a wide range of PHP development services. Our team of skilled PHP website designers has extensive experience in creating custom PHP applications tailored to your specific needs.
Here are some of the PHP development services we offer
Custom PHP development: We can create custom PHP applications to meet your unique business requirements.
PHP website development: We specialize in developing dynamic and user-friendly PHP websites.
E-commerce development with PHP: We can build robust e-commerce platforms using PHP frameworks like Magento, WooCommerce, or Laravel.
PHP migration and modernization: We can help you migrate your existing PHP applications to newer versions or modernize your legacy systems.
By partnering with Concept Infoway, you can benefit from our expertise, quality, and commitment to delivering exceptional PHP development services.
Hire PHP Developers?
Contact Us Today!Why Choose Concept Infoway for Your PHP Development Needs?
Concept Infoway is a leading custom website design company specializing in PHP development. With years of experience and a team of skilled PHP developers, we are committed to delivering robust, secure, and tailored solutions to meet your unique business requirements.
Here is why you should choose Concept Infoway for your PHP development needs:
Expert PHP Developers
Our team consists of highly skilled PHP developers who are passionate about creating innovative and efficient web applications. With a deep understanding of the language and its frameworks, our developers can deliver top-quality solutions that meet your specific needs.
Customized Website Design Solutions
We believe in creating custom website design solutions that are tailored to your brand and target audience. Our developers will work closely with you to understand your business objectives and develop a website that aligns with your vision.
Robust and Scalable Applications
We prioritize building robust and scalable PHP applications that can manage increasing traffic and growth. Our developers use best practices and industry-standard tools to ensure your website is reliable, secure, and performant.
Comprehensive PHP Development Services
In addition to custom website design, we offer a comprehensive range of PHP development services, including:
E-commerce development: Creating online stores with advanced features and payment gateways.
Content management systems (CMS): Developing custom CMS solutions to manage your website content efficiently.
Web application development: Building custom web applications to meet your specific business needs.
API integration: Integrating your website with third-party services and APIs.
Maintenance and support: Providing ongoing maintenance and support for your PHP applications.
Agile Development Methodology
We follow an agile development methodology to ensure flexibility, transparency, and continuous improvement throughout the development process. This approach allows us to adapt to changing requirements and deliver the project on time and within budget.
Focus on Security and Performance
Security and performance are top priorities in our PHP development process. We implement robust security measures to protect your website and data, and we optimize your website for speed and efficiency.
Client Satisfaction
Our goal is to exceed your expectations and deliver exceptional results. We maintain open communication with our clients throughout the development process and strive to build long-lasting partnerships.
By choosing Concept Infoway for your PHP development needs, you can be confident that you are partnering with a reputable custom website design company that is dedicated to delivering high-quality solutions. Contact us today to discuss your project and learn more about how we can help you achieve your business goals.
Conclusion:
Custom website design powered by PHP offers numerous benefits for businesses seeking to establish a strong online presence. By partnering with a skilled PHP website designer like Concept Infoway, you can create a robust, secure, and visually appealing website that meets your unique requirements.
Our team of experts specializes in custom website design and PHP development, ensuring that your website is not only functional but also aesthetically pleasing and user-friendly. We prioritize security and performance to protect your data and provide a seamless experience for your visitors.
With our comprehensive website design services, you can rest assured that your website will be designed to drive traffic, generate leads, and enhance your brand’s reputation. Contact us today to learn more about how our custom website design solutions can help you achieve your business goals.
Frequently Asked Questions – FAQs
How can I make a custom website?
There are two main ways to create a custom website:
Do it yourself: You can use website builders or content management systems (CMS) to create a basic website. However, for complex or highly customized websites, it is often better to hire a professional website design service.
Hire a professional: Custom website design companies specialize in creating unique and tailored websites. They have the expertise and tools to design and develop a website that meets your specific needs.
How much does a custom-coded website cost?
The cost of a custom website can vary widely depending on factors such as:
Complexity: The more complex your website, the higher the cost will be.
Features: The number and type of features you require will also affect the price.
Design: A custom design can be more expensive than using a template.
Developer's experience: The experience and expertise of the website design company you choose will also impact the cost.
Are custom websites worth it?
Custom websites are definitely worth it if you want a unique and professional online presence. They offer several advantages, including:
Better user experience: Custom websites can be tailored to your specific needs and preferences, providing a better user experience.
Improved SEO: Custom websites can be optimized for search engines, helping you rank higher in search results.
Increased conversions: A well-designed custom website can help you convert more visitors into customers.
Long-term value: Custom websites are a long-term investment that can continue to benefit your business for years to come.
How much does it cost to customize a website?
The cost of customizing a website depends on the extent of the customizations required. If you are starting with a template, the cost will be lower than if you are creating a completely custom design. However, even minor customizations can add to the overall cost.
Can you build a website with PHP?
Yes, PHP is a popular programming language used to build dynamic and interactive websites. It's particularly well-suited for creating custom website design projects, as it offers flexibility, scalability, and a wide range of features.
What is a custom PHP website?
A custom PHP website is a website that is tailored specifically to your unique needs and goals. It's built using PHP programming language, allowing for dynamic content, interactive features, and database integration. Unlike pre-built templates, a custom PHP website offers complete customization, ensuring that it aligns perfectly with your brand identity and business objectives.
Is PHP used for web design?
Yes, PHP is widely used for web design. It's a server-side scripting language, meaning it runs on the web server rather than the client's computer. This enables PHP to process data, generate dynamic content, and interact with databases, making it a powerful tool for creating complex and engaging websites.
What are the benefits of a custom website design?
A custom website design offers several advantages over pre-built templates. It allows for complete customization, ensuring that your website aligns perfectly with your brand identity and business objectives. A custom website design can also provide better user experience, improved search engine optimization (SEO), and enhanced functionality to meet your specific needs.
How long does it take to create a custom website design?
The timeline for creating a custom website design can vary depending on the complexity of the project and the specific requirements. Factors such as the number of pages, the level of customization, and the integration of features can influence the development time. While smaller projects may be completed in a few weeks, larger and more complex websites can take several months. It's essential to discuss your project's timeline with your chosen web development team to get a more accurate estimate.